PART 5: Styling Text with CSS The first HTML element that we will style are texts. We shall start from text because, it is logically the most basic and important element on a page. We shall treat first treat how to change the color of text. Editing Text Color: To change the color of text, a method we can use is to modify the paragraph tag. Before we proceed,it should be noted that the convention of writing colors in CSS is the same as that in HTML i.e HEX values, color names,e.t.c Syntax p { NOTE: This syntax is used for internal and external sheets. Throughout these CSS tutorials we will be using CSS syntax as if we were writing the CSS rules in an external sheet. We shall not use inline styles as this will defy the real purpose of CSS. However, if you want to style a paragraph directly in an HTML document-inline style- we will just include the style attribute in the opening <p> tag. <p style="color:green;"> This text will be written in green.</p> So, any text written between the opening and closing <p> tags in the HTML document would now be green in color. 4 Likes 3 Shares |

Editing Text Alignment: If you use Microsoft Word, you should be familiar with text-align. With a value of center, yor text will be centralized, while justify will make all the lines of text have equal width. There are two other values- left and right. If you use one these, the text either aligns to the left or right of its container. Syntax: p{text-align:center;} p.one{text-align:justify;} p.two{text-align:left;} p.three{text-align:right;} NOTE: The p, p.one, p.two and p.three are examples only. 4 Likes 3 Shares |

PART 6: Styling Backgrounds with CSS We shall now learn how to style backgrounds. This is the first time we will be treating this, both in our HTML and CSS courses, so let me give you a gist about it. When used in CSS, background applies to the background of an element. Simple. Now, with CSS we can change the color of a background and even include an image as background. It is noted that the background attribute can be used with most HTML elements like p and h tags. Syntax: First, we treat how to change the background color. body {background-color:aqua;} NOTE: This syntax means that the body of the page in this case, would be aqua. We can also,definitely,replace the selector-body with any other valid selector 4 Likes 4 Shares |

Secondly, we treat how to include a background image. body {background-image:https://www.nairaland.com/stock/image.jpg;} NOTE: Of course as you may imagine,https://www.nairaland.com/stock/image.jpg, is just an example. You can specify the url of the image anyhow, as long as it is the correct address. 3 Likes 3 Shares |

When an image is included as the background, the image fills its container by repeating itself left to right, up to down. This is the default setting. However, we can overcome this by using this syntax: body { background-image:https://www.nairaland.com/stock/image.jpg;; background-repeat:no-repeat; } This will make the image appear once. 3 Likes 3 Shares |

PART 7: Styling Fonts of Text Once again, we treat an untouched aspect-fonts. I am sure most of you know what fonts are. Just for clarity, they define the way a text appears i.e its design, boldness, style, e.t.c. So while you will use the color attribute to change the color of a text, you will use the font, for fonts. 3 Likes 2 Shares |

The terms that most of us familiarize with the term 'fonts'- Times New Roman,Comic Sans, e.t.c are more detailed. Fonts could be classified as a generic or font family. 1)Generic Family: This classifies fonts in a general way. It is the main classification of fonts. You might have heard of the terms 'serif' and 'sans serif'. They are part of the generic family. The generic family consists of, in full: a)Serif:Fonts that fall under serif(e.g Times New Roman) have lines at the end of most of their characters and thus, tend to be used for designed texts. b)Sans Serif: These are the opposite of serif. They do not have these little lines and thus are used in context with much words. E.g Arial c)Mono Space: Mono means one. These fonts have significant 'one space' between each character. E.g Lucida Console 5 Likes 2 Shares |
